3. Thunderbolt Ross Was Supposed To Die - Captain America: Brave New World
Though the vast majority of MCU outings have gone through reshoots for a multitude of different reasons, reports told of Captain America: Brave New World going through this process like nothing before. To read everything that was written, you would think an entirely new movie was made, and to a degree it was.
The Serpent Society were removed altogether, while Giancarlo Esposito's Sidewinder was added into the mix, and there was also a funeral scene cut. This would have in all likelihood been for Thunderbolt Ross, played of course in the film by Harrison Ford.
A huge part of the story's conflict comes from Ross slowly dying, and being saved somewhat by Samuel Sterns' (Tim Blake Nelson) pills, while there were paparazzi shots of the scene being filmed featuring the cherry blossoms that meant so much to Ross and his daughter, Betty (Liv Tyler). So we can safely take from this that Ford's character was not originally meant to survive.
In fairness, killing an actor like Harrison Ford off the moment he joins the MCU would be bordering on insanity, but potentially the bigger takeaway is that his fate must have been changed for a reason. Was he sent to the Raft instead of a grave because he has a role to play further down the Marvel line? Who wouldn't say no to that?
